RYECO offers a system which solves the problems associated with inefficient and messy paper edge markers. The 3160 Edge Marking System precisely marks the edge of the web with up to six colors. The marker can be activated by any defect inspection system, scanner or manually via the operator interface panel. Precise identification of all defective and off-spec product improves both runability and quality.

EMM-2000 Edge Marking Module: The EMM-2000 marks the top and/or bottom surfaces of one edge with any one of six colors. The six colors are derived from only three dye tanks thus eliminating unnecessary hardware. The system uses two spray nozzles to ensure a mark even if one becomes plugged. The automatic water purge system cleans the marker internally to minimize nozzle clogging. All waste water and over spray dye is collected and siphoned through a static vacuum pump to the sewer. During web breaks, the marker and vacuum pump are automatically purged with water for two minutes. The premixed dye is replenished in remotely located storage tanks. All RYECO dyes are certified by the FDA for use in food products.

ETM-1000 Edge Tracking Module: The ETM-1000 maintains the position of the other modules on the edge of the moving web. The point of inspection is adjustable within 3/16" of the edge. The system automatically retracts upon occurrence of a web break. The ETM-1000 Edge Tracking ModuleƖ consists of an intra-red edge sensor and a sealed electrical linear actuator. A local control panel allows for manual or automatic edge tracking.

EBM-100 Edge Base Module: The EBM-100 contains the support hardware and software for the system. It includes a mini-computer with a 24 button operator interface panel. Ample digital I/O allows for interfacing to existing process control equipment. Programs are maintained in EEPROM and battery back-up RAM. Software changes, available free for the first year, are easily accomplished by swapping EEPROM modules. A 24 volt DC power supply provides all control voltages for the system.

RYECO's Edge Marking Systems include features which reduce maintenance and improve reliability over other marking systems. The system is completely modular and has all quick-disconnect electrical and tubing connections. There are no exposed tubing or cables over the web to be damaged or pulled loose.

The RYECO 3160 Edge Marking System™ software features make operating the system simple and easy.

The keypad and 16 character alphanumeric display allow for easy access to system parameters such as mark length and fade length. An approaching defect indicator is provided, via color fade, for ease of locating during unwind. A mark is automatically created at reel change to indicate that the marker is on line and functioning.
